Regarding Mailbox Compartment Numbering

Rather than assigning mailbox ID plates that match apartment or house numbers, sequential or standard numbering may help you meet the accessibility regulations related to your project. Standard numbering may also provide greater security and privacy for residents.

Required Height from the Floor

Mounting at specified heights AFF (Above Finished Floor) ensure USPS installation requirements are met.

  • If your installation is for USPS delivery and contains any tenant compartments in the bottom row, the minimum height from the floor is 28 inches.
  • If your installation contains no tenant compartments in the bottom row, you have the option to install at a minimum of 15 inches from the floor to be compliant with ADA and USPS requirements.

Postal Delivery

If USPS carriers will deliver mail to every tenant box, then you will need the STD-4C mailbox. It must also be installed according to specifications as outlined by USPS STD-4C regulations (see here for details). Also, all installations must have one parcel locker for every ten mailboxes (a 1:10 ratio). Be sure to check with your local post office prior to planning any mailbox installation, to make sure you are meeting local requirements for proper placement.

Private Delivery

What is private mail delivery?
When the USPS mail carrier delivers mail to one centralized business location and then the facility manager or entrusted individual distributes the mail to all the individual tenant compartments, it is considered private delivery (most commonly used in dorm settings). Mailboxes for private delivery do not have to conform to current postal regulations and therefore provide additional customization options over USPS Approved equipment. The entire Versatile (TM) 4C mailbox line may be used for private delivery, if desired. You can select this option directly from any of the Florence Mailboxes 4C product pages.

Meeting USPS Installation Requirements

Florence Manufacturing USPS Approved 4C mailbox products are designed to adhere to STD-4C regulations. To ensure your project complies with USPS regulations for wall-mounted mailboxes, your mailbox center must be installed according to the following U.S. Postal Service guidelines:

Installation requirements specified in the U.S. Postal Service STD-4C regulation are outlined below:

  1. At least one customer compartment shall be positioned less than 48 inches above the finished floor.
  2. No parcel locker compartment (interior bottom shelf) shall be positioned less than 15 inches above the finished floor.
  3. No customer lock shall be located more than 67 inches above the finished floor.
  4. No customer compartment (interior bottom shelf) shall be positioned less than 28 inches above the finished floor.
  5. The USPS Arrow lock shall be located between 36 and 48 inches above the finished floor.

Meeting ADA Installation Requirements

Accessibility regulations may vary by type of facility and by governing jurisdictions. Therefore, always consult local building officials and codes for applicable accessibility requirements that could affect your mailbox project. Below are industry references for your convenience.

Stan
2010 ADA Standards for Accessible Design, Department of Justice Code of Federal Regulations, ADA CHAPTER 2: SCOPING REQUIREMENTS, 228.2 Mail Boxes: Where mail boxes are provided in an interior location, at least 5 percent, but no fewer than one, of each type shall comply with 309. In residential facilities, where mail boxes are provided for each residential dwelling unit, mail boxes complying with 309 shall be provided for each residential dwelling unit required to provide mobility features complying with 809.2 through 809.4.

U.S. Postal Service STD-4C Specification Highlights

Effective October 5, 2006, all new designs approved for NEW CONSTRUCTION AND MAJOR RENOVATION require U.S. Postal Service STD-4C compliant mailbox systems. The new USPS 4C Standard includes the following specifications:

  • A new compartment form factor minimum size requirement of 12 in. w in. 15 in. d in. 3 in. h.
  • Eliminates the vertical form factor (5 in. w in. 6 in. d in. 15 in. h) design.
  • Introduces a parcel locker requirement based on a 1:10 parcel locker to customer compartment ratio.
  • Strengthens security requirements for the entire receptacle.
  • Standardizes and improves tenant compartment lock design.
  • Adds testing requirements to verify acceptability for either indoor or outdoor use.
  • Introduces quality management systems provisions.
  • Enhances design flexibility for concept, ergonomics, and materials.
  • Meets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) standards.

Q2. HOW DO THE NEW REGULATIONS AFFECT HOW I BUY CENTRALIZED MAILBOXES?

The three (3) simple questions below will help you determine the right wall-mounted mailbox product for your project.

  1. Are the mailboxes being used in new construction?
    a.If so, only 4C rated wall-mounted mailboxes or free-standing CBU products can be used.
  2. If renovating in. are the mailboxes simply being replaced using the same rough opening (RO)?
    a.If so, then 4B+ rated verticals or horizontals can be used.
    b.If adjusting RO, then new 4C rated mailboxes must be used.
  3. Is the mailbox installation inside or outside?
    a.If inside, any model can be used depending on answer to Q1a & Q2a/b above.
    b.If outside and unprotected , install 4C or CBU products as 4B+ rated verticals and horizontals are NOT rated for outside use.
STD 4B
Q3. WHAT DOES MAJOR RENOVATION MEAN?

A major renovation would occur anytime the condition of the wall is being modified where the existing wall-mounted mailboxes are presently installed. If the cavity of the wall is altered in such a manner the mailboxes can t be reinstalled on a one-for-one basis, the renovation would be considered major and mailboxes complying with the new USPS STD-4C regulation should be installed.

If you have any questions about which USPS mailbox Standard will be applied to a specific project requiring USPS Approved mailboxes, please contact the local Postmaster or Postal Delivery Planning Official for guidance prior to purchasing any wall-mounted mailbox systems.
